How to prepare for a job interview at Lexington-Catering
✨Know Your Culinary Style
Before the interview, take some time to reflect on your culinary style and philosophy. Be ready to discuss how it aligns with Lexington's focus on great food and service. This will show that you understand their values and can contribute positively to their team.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Head Chef, you'll be leading a team, so it's crucial to demonstrate your leadership abilities.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ed a kitchen, resolved conflicts, or inspired your team in previous roles. This will help them see you as a strong candidate for the position.
✨Be Ready for Practical Questions
Expect questions about menu planning, food safety, and kitchen management. Brush up on these topics and think of specific instances where you've excelled. This will not only showcase your expertise but also your problem-solving skills in a real kitchen environment.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team dynamics, the types of events they cater, or how they measure success in their kitchens.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you determine if it's the right fit for you.
